public override void Execute(object parameter) { var SelectedText = _IDEProvider.GetSelectedText(); if (!string.IsNullOrEmpty(SelectedText)) { WindowFtoggle wf = new WindowFtoggle(SelectedText); wf.Show(); } }
public override void Execute(object parameter) { var SelectedText = _IDEProvider.GetSelectedText().Trim(); if (!Regex.IsMatch(SelectedText, @"^[a-z0-9_]+$", RegexOptions.IgnoreCase)) { throw new Exception($"Ошибочный текст для поиска в Dicti:\r\n{SelectedText}"); } WindowDicti wd = new WindowDicti(SelectedText); wd.Show(); }